Océ JetStream 1000

Taking center stage
in the Océ booth will be the new Océ JetStream 1000, the latest of the company's JetStream family of inkjet printers. But understand this: the Océ JetStream 1000 is not just another roll-fed inkjet print engine. This is the only continuous feed inkjet system available today that can print duplex pages within a single print engine and with  a 30 percent smaller footprint than most competitive machines. This means more performance in less floor space and far more capabilities and productivity than other competitive offerings and any machines it might replace.

The compact size belies its performance: It can print using up to six colors in a single pass while churning out 1,070 letter-size duplex pages per minute with a monthly duty cycle of up to 33 million impressions. Even more compelling for many printers, one of these "colors" can be Océ's unique integrated MICR ink, enabling a host of applications requiring the security only MICR provides. Its compact size and ability to integrate MICR into color and monochrome documents are persuasive advantages for print providers seeking a way to move up to full-color inkjet without getting a system with too much capacity, or one that takes up a lot of shop floor real estate.

All this performance also enables exceptional versatility. Speeding off the Océ JetStream 1000 at PRINT 09 will full color books, a newspaper, and trans-promo applications with integrated MICR and CPSA-compliant security features. There'll also be a survey containing a QR code, giving attendees the option of completing the survey online. (Don't know what a QR code is? Keep reading!)

With this new machine the Océ JetStream family now ranges from 537 to more than 3,000 letter-size pages per minute, and with MICR printing, delivers the broadest range of inkjet color printing capabilities available today.




About Océ
Océ is a leading international provider of digital document management technology and services.  The company’s solutions are based on Océ’s advanced software applications that deliver documents and data over internal networks and the Internet to printing devices and archives -- locally and around the world.  Supporting the workflow solutions are Océ digital printers and scanners, considered the most reliable and productive in the world.  Océ also offers a wide range of display graphics, consulting and outsourcing solutions.

Océ employs around 23,000 people, with 2008 revenues of approximately $4.3 billion, operates in more than 90 countries and maintains research and manufacturing centers in the Netherlands, the United States, Canada, Germany, France, Belgium, the Czech Republic, Romania and Singapore.  Océ North America is headquartered in Trumbull, CT, with additional business units in Chicago, IL; New York City; Boca Raton, FL; Salt Lake City, UT and Vancouver, BC.  North American revenues represented approximately half of Océ’s worldwide business in 2008, and employment is approximately 10,000.  For more information about Océ, visit www.oceusa.com.  Outside the U.S., consult www.oce.com.
